British Columbia’s winters have always been unpredictable, but the past few seasons have introduced a new level of volatility that has caught many property managers, business owners, and residential communities off guard. Sudden freeze–thaw cycles, overnight black-ice formation, and increasingly sharp temperature drops have made traditional “wait-and-see” winter maintenance strategies nearly obsolete.

This shift has created a pressing need for smarter solutions—ones that combine real-time weather intelligence, reliable contractor networks, safety-driven dispatching, and transparent reporting. The Hidden Cost of Unpredictable Winter Hazards

Even a single slip-and-fall incident can cost a property thousands in legal fees, insurance premium increases, and operational disruption. Many incidents happen not during heavy snowfall, but during marginal temperature hours—those tricky windows around +1°C to +4°C where surface temperatures dip below freezing even while the air appears safe.

Why Vancouver Needs Smarter Winter Maintenance

Vancouver’s coastal climate creates one of the most challenging winter environments in the country. Snowfall is intermittent, but freezing conditions are frequent—and unpredictable. Ice can form with no snowfall whatsoever, making it one of the top cities where proactive salting strategies matter more than plowing alone.

Luxembourg has become the first Eurozone country to invest part of its sovereign wealth fund in Bitcoin. During the presentation of the 2026 Budget at the Chambre des Deputes, Finance Minister Gilles Roth confirmed that the Fonds Souverain Intergenerationnel du Luxembourg (FSIL) — the nation’s sovereign wealth fund — has allocated 1% of its portfolio to Bitcoin. Luxembourg’s Bitcoin play According to Bob Kieffer, Director of the Treasury, the decision reflects “the growing maturity of this new asset class” and “leadership in digital finance.” Under the FSIL’s revised investment policy, up to 15% of total assets can now be placed in alternative investments. This includes investments in private equity, real estate, and crypto assets. The Bitcoin exposure, roughly €8.5 million [around $9 million USD], is being made through ETFs to avoid custody and operational risks. Kieffer also acknowledged differing opinions about the move. He said,  “Some might argue that we’re committing too little too late; others will point out the volatility and speculative nature of the investment. Yet, given the FSIL’s mission, a 1% allocation strikes the right balance while sending a clear message about Bitcoin’s long-term potential.” A cautious, but symbolic shift The FSIL, created in 2014 to preserve wealth across generations, now manages roughly €850 million. The announcement also comes on the back of Luxembourg tightening its digital asset regulatory framework, while preparing to implement DAC8.
